I have a 75 gallon saltwater tank wanted to use a ac110 for xtra media. I want to use bio-balls in it. Any suggestions on this or something else to use.
 
I was told that bioballs wouldn't be effective in eheims and aquaclears by the manager of my lfs. He said its not the same as when they are used w/ the trickle down method of a wet/dry filter. I use ac110 on my 125s as extra filtration w/ the sponge block and a big bag of chemi pure, works well 4 me.

Bio balls are great for breaking streams of water down into drops of water in wet/dry trickle filters. They are pretty much a waster in submerged applications.

Ceramic and sintered glass media is great for submerged media because of its large surface area for volume. I usually buy the Eheim brand submerged media but there are other great submerged medias out there.
